Nice family fair, something for everyone. Had 4H competitions like farm animals, quilts, pies. Lots of food trucks, famous funnel cakes, fried liver, lemonade, hamburguers, bratwurst, kettle corn, ice cream, and more. Demolition cars show. Very organized fair.

Over all, a great space to rent out. Typically hosting the county fair and various charity events, this large lot with multiple sized buildings is a good start. However, the buildings are not at all constructed to keep out heat in the summer nor cold in the winter. Industrial fans will be needed to keep the event space cool enough to stand on the hottest days. Often people will cool off in their cars, then return to the event--a rather large downside for charity and personal events.
